One of the greatest sorrows of Mary, was when her son being taken from her and laid in the tomb, she remained entirely alone and desolate: for the time when a mother most feels the loss of her son is after he has been buried and she sees him no more. For this reason those who love Mother Mary try, as of old did John and Magdalen to comfort her in her profound grief.
Taken from the Servite Manual on the Hour of Desolation
